Mount Gay Black Barrel 43°: Description and customer reviews

Mount Gay Black Barrel is a traditional rum from the island of Barbados created by master blender Allan Smith and produced in a limited edition.

It is a mixture of rums distilled in iron stills (used for Scotch whiskies and cognacs, for example) and old rums distilled in a column still (classically used for rum). All are matured in American oak barrels that have previously contained bourbon and have been deeply burnt to allow the wood to reveal its aromas.

The whole process results in a well-balanced and highly aromatic rum.

Nico's tasting note

The nose is initially marked by notes of leather, warm toasted bread and toasted wood. Molasses and coffee take over, but gently, wrapped in vanilla.
This simple and pleasant profile is completed by stewed fruit, notably banana.

The palate is easy, first slightly gripped by spices, then by a vanilla woodiness. The sensation is light and a little thick on the palate.

The finish is briefly reminiscent of a gingerbread with honey.
